Salesforce Consultant
The HR part was really chill and informal. But then the project managers and business analysts were more serious, and they wanted me to explain some solutions on the whiteboard.
- Can you tell me about your salary expectations?
- Please demonstrate some solutions on the whiteboard.
Project Manager
There were 3 rounds in total. The first was with HR. The second was with someone doing the same job as me. The third round was with HR and two managers. It was a bit weird doing the second interview with someone I might work with, before meeting my future manager.
- What's your approach to dealing with project issues?
Software Engineer
I was initially contacted by a recruiter on Linkedin. Then, I had two phone interviews: one with the recruiter and another with a senior software engineer. The in-person interviews were split into two parts. The first in-person interview involved meeting with the president, the recruiter who reached out, and the VP of delivery solutions. The second in-person interview was with the recruiter again and the VP of HR. I actually had a good time during the interviews and didn't feel nervous, which might be because I put in a lot of preparation time, like checking out the website, looking into who would be interviewing me, and reading company reviews.
- What makes you want to join our company?
- What's prompting your interest in leaving your current role?
- Could you teach us something on the whiteboard?
Consultant
First, I had a phone call with HR where we talked about the job, the company vibes, and benefits. Then, a technical lead called me to ask about my tech skills and work history. After that, there was an online test to check if I had the right technical and functional skills. Finally, I went in person to interview with some big bosses and people on the team. I got the offer really fast, like in under a week. We negotiated for a day or so, and then I accepted.
- Can you tell me about your technical skills and your experience in this field?
- Could you elaborate on your job experience and how it relates to this role?
- What are your thoughts on our company culture and values?
